
Shuffle Design CLI
Shuffle Design CLI è uno strumento "terminal-first" che genera o riprogetta intere landing page utilizzando i migliori modelli AI e produce HTML + Tailwind CSS puliti e modificabili che puoi visualizzare in anteprima, modificare in Shuffle e scaricare localmente.
https://shuffle.dev/design-cli?ref=producthunt&utm_source=aipure

Informazioni sul Prodotto
Aggiornato:May 25, 2026
Cos'è Shuffle Design CLI
Shuffle Design CLI è la versione a riga di comando degli strumenti di progettazione AI di Shuffle, creata per aiutare sviluppatori e team a creare nuovi design di siti web o a modernizzare quelli esistenti direttamente da script, lavori CI o flussi di lavoro quotidiani del terminale. Con un singolo comando, puoi generare più varianti di design in parallelo da un prompt, o riprogettare un sito web live fornendo il suo URL e una direzione di design. Ogni risultato viene consegnato come HTML e Tailwind CSS pronti per la modifica, con collegamenti per visualizzare in anteprima il design e aprirlo nell'Editor Shuffle per l'iterazione visiva.
Caratteristiche principali di Shuffle Design CLI
Shuffle Design CLI è uno strumento da riga di comando che genera nuovi design di siti web/landing page e riprogetta siti web esistenti direttamente dal tuo terminale. Può eseguire più modelli AI di design leader (ad esempio, Claude, GPT, Gemini, Kimi) per produrre diverse varianti in parallelo, quindi fornisce link di anteprima/editor ospitati e ti permette di scaricare progetti HTML + Tailwind CSS puliti e modificabili per lo sviluppo locale. È stato creato per l'automazione – utilizzabile in script, lavori CI e strumenti interni – e può anche essere integrato in flussi di lavoro come bot di Slack o pipeline di outreach.
Generazione di design "terminal-first": Crea pagine di destinazione complete da un prompt con un singolo comando (ad esempio, `npx @shuffle-dev/cli design create "..."`) e ricevi più varianti di design da confrontare.
Riprogettazione di siti web basata su AI da un URL: Riprogetta qualsiasi sito live fornendo un URL e una direzione; la CLI acquisisce screenshot della pagina e genera un design aggiornato con lo stesso contenuto (ad esempio, `npx @shuffle-dev/cli redesign create https://example.com "..."`).
Supporto multi-modello e varianti parallele: Supporta i principali modelli AI e può eseguire i modelli selezionati (o tutti i modelli attivi) per generare alternative affiancate per un'esplorazione più rapida e risultati migliori.
Output pulito: HTML + Tailwind CSS: Genera codice front-end pronto per la modifica (HTML e Tailwind CSS) progettato per essere ispezionabile, modificabile e distribuibile, anziché bloccato in un formato proprietario.
Flusso di lavoro di download e sincronizzazione locale: Scarica i progetti generati sulla tua macchina (ad esempio, `npx @shuffle-dev/cli get <project_id> --output=...`) e mantieni il lavoro allineato tra l'editor di Shuffle e gli ambienti di sviluppo locali.
Opzioni CLI adatte all'automazione: Include flag per la scelta dei modelli, l'esecuzione di tutti i modelli, il download automatico degli output, la generazione di screenshot e il salvataggio di metadati/URL di esecuzione per flussi di lavoro scriptati ripetibili.
Casi d'uso di Shuffle Design CLI
Proposte di aggiornamento per clienti di agenzie: Genera rapidamente versioni ridisegnate del sito attuale di un cliente dal suo URL per proporre nuove direzioni e accelerare le approvazioni prima dell'implementazione.
Pagine di destinazione di marketing SaaS su larga scala: Genera più varianti di landing page da prompt, confrontale ed esporta HTML/Tailwind modificabili per spedire esperimenti e test A/B più velocemente.
Offerte di riprogettazione per vendite/outreach: Automatizza le anteprime di riprogettazione specifiche per i potenziali clienti e invia outreach personalizzati (ad esempio, tramite un flusso di lavoro email) monitorando i file generati e i messaggi inviati.
Richieste di design tramite Slack per i team: Usa l'approccio del bot Slack fornito in modo che i membri del team possano richiedere nuovi design o riprogettazioni direttamente nei canali, centralizzando le operazioni di design negli strumenti di comunicazione esistenti.
CI/automazione per l'esplorazione del design: Esegui la generazione di design in script o lavori CI per produrre output di design coerenti e ripetibili per la revisione interna, l'esplorazione di sistemi di design o la prototipazione rapida.
Vantaggi
Creazione e riprogettazione di design veloci e ripetibili tramite semplici comandi da terminale, ben adatti all'automazione e alla CI.
La generazione multi-modello produce più varianti rapidamente, migliorando l'esplorazione e il processo decisionale.
Gli output sono scaricabili come HTML + Tailwind CSS puliti e modificabili, consentendo un facile passaggio agli sviluppatori.
Svantaggi
Richiede autenticazione e l'uso della piattaforma di Shuffle per i link di modifica/anteprima e la gestione dei progetti.
Ideale per flussi di lavoro HTML/Tailwind; i team che utilizzano altri stack potrebbero aver bisogno di adattamenti o lavori di conversione aggiuntivi.
La modalità di riprogettazione dipende dall'acquisizione di screenshot di un URL live, che potrebbe essere limitata da restrizioni di accesso al sito o da pagine dinamiche/autenticate.
Come usare Shuffle Design CLI
1) Prerequisiti: Installa Node.js (in modo da poter usare npx/npm). Shuffle Design CLI funziona tramite npx o può essere installato globalmente.
2) Installa (opzionale) o esegui tramite npx: Opzione A (nessuna installazione): esegui i comandi con `npx @shuffle-dev/cli ...`. Opzione B (installazione globale): `npm install -g @shuffle-dev/cli`.
3) Autenticati: Esegui `npx @shuffle-dev/cli auth` e completa il flusso di accesso del browser che si apre automaticamente. Dovresti vedere "Autenticazione riuscita!" una volta terminato.
4) Esplora i comandi disponibili: Esegui `npx @shuffle-dev/cli --help` per vedere i comandi di livello superiore. Per l'aiuto sulla generazione di design, esegui `npx @shuffle-dev/cli design create --help`.
5) Crea un design completamente nuovo da un prompt: Genera una landing page (o qualsiasi pagina) da linguaggio semplice: `npx @shuffle-dev/cli design create "landing page per ..."`. La CLI restituisce un ID di progetto più URL di modifica/anteprima (e opzionalmente un URL di screenshot).
6) Scegli i modelli (interattivi, specifici o tutti): Per generare con modelli specifici: `npx @shuffle-dev/cli design create -m <id> "..."` (ripeti `-m` o usa ID separati da virgola). Per eseguire tutti i modelli di design attivi senza selezionare interattivamente: aggiungi `--all`.
7) Scarica automaticamente i file generati dopo ogni esecuzione (opzionale): Aggiungi `--download [directory]` per scaricare i file di progetto dopo ogni generazione riuscita, ad esempio `npx @shuffle-dev/cli design create --download ./out "..."`.
8) Scarica solo i file sorgente (opzionale): Quando usi `--download`, aggiungi `--source-only` per estrarre solo i file sorgente: `npx @shuffle-dev/cli design create --download ./out --source-only "..."`.
9) Genera screenshot (opzionale): Aggiungi `--screenshot` per generare uno screenshot per ogni progetto creato: `npx @shuffle-dev/cli design create --screenshot "..."`.
10) Salva gli URL di output in un file (opzionale): Aggiungi `--save-output <file>` per memorizzare l'output (inclusi gli URL) in un file: `npx @shuffle-dev/cli design create --save-output results.json "..."`.
11) Riprogetta un sito web esistente da un URL: Fornisci un URL live più una direzione di riprogettazione: `npx @shuffle-dev/cli redesign create https://example.com "..."`. La CLI fa uno screenshot della pagina e genera varianti riprogettate con lo stesso contenuto ma un aspetto nuovo.
12) Apri il progetto generato nell'Editor Shuffle: Usa l'URL "Modifica" restituito (ad esempio, `https://shuffle.dev/editor?project=...`) per rivedere e personalizzare il design visivamente in Shuffle.
13) Scarica un progetto in seguito tramite ID progetto: Se hai già un ID progetto, scaricalo con: `npx @shuffle-dev/cli get <project_id> --output=./landing-page`.
14) Sincronizza un progetto Shuffle localmente (flusso di lavoro opzionale): Per mantenere una cartella locale sincronizzata con un progetto Shuffle, usa: `npx @shuffle-dev/cli sync <project_id>` (l'ID del progetto si trova nell'URL dell'Editor Shuffle).
15) Utilizza nell'automazione (CI/script/bot): Poiché tutto è basato su comandi (prompt, riprogettazione URL, selezione modello, download, screenshot, salvataggio output), puoi eseguirlo in script, lavori CI o strumenti interni per generare varianti e artefatti di design ripetibili.
FAQ di Shuffle Design CLI
Shuffle Design CLI è uno strumento da riga di comando che ti consente di generare nuovi design di siti web/landing page e riprogettare siti web esistenti direttamente dal terminale, producendo HTML e Tailwind CSS puliti e modificabili.
Articoli Popolari

Atoms: Una Piattaforma AI Multi-Agente Che Trasforma le Idee in Prodotti Pronti al Lancio
May 22, 2026

Nano Banana SBTI: Cos'è, come funziona e come usarlo nel 2026
Apr 15, 2026

Recensione di Atoms — Il builder di prodotti AI che ridefinisce la creazione digitale nel 2026
Apr 10, 2026

Kilo Claw: Come Distribuire e Utilizzare un Vero Agente AI "Fai-da-Te" (Aggiornamento 2026)
Apr 3, 2026







